Position: Sourcing Specialist
The Sourcing Specialist will actively manage the hotel and ground transportation procurement process for our clients.
Responsibilities include creating hotel market analyses, identifying industry trends, sourcing multiple destinations, negotiating with hotels and ground transportation providers and tracking financial data.
Essential Functions
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
Source hotels and collect market data for clients in key destinations.
Collect data such as hotel names, addresses, key contact information and star ratings utilizing internal databases and internet sources.
Manage the Request for Proposal/Request for Information process through API's RFP platform, JET, to secure and negotiate rates, special concessions, contract terms and conditions with hotel and ground transportation suppliers.
Research hotel options and track collected data in Salesforce database.
Analyze market trends and conditions in order to secure the best possible scenarios for our airlines and hotel partners.
Create high quality and detailed destination presentations utilizing Microsoft products and Adobe programs that demonstrate savings and meet revenue goals within established deadlines.
Prepare hotel site inspection scheduling domestically and internationally when required for customers.
Manage crewmember feedback via our online portal for assigned accounts ensuring complaints/compliments are addressed within airline-specific contracted Service Level Agreement (SLA).
